Alumni Weekend is around the corner. This year, we are honoring 100 years of excellence, and we can't wait to celebrate with you. Our theme for alumni weekend is "100 Years & Counting: Committed to Our Heritage." The weekend will be filled with 3 days of events, starting with a "Day of Service" on Friday, and ending with an Alumni Brunch on Sunday. All In Membership Campaign

The 'All In' Membership is $100. Membership includes one-year membership to the NCCU National Alumni Association, Inc. ($50 value), AND one-year membership to a local NCCU Alumni Chapter ($30 value), AND a tax-deductible donation of $20 to the NCCU annual scholarship fund. Please note, if you do not select an NCCU Alumni Chapter, the funds will go to NCCU Alumni Association, Inc. Membership is valid from July 1 through June 30.
